Individual Details

David ADAMS

(29 Mar 1699 - 21 May 1759)

Dates and places for this family are from Mayflower Families Through Five Generations, Volume Six, Family - Stephen Hopkins, by John D.Austin, Published by General Society of Mayflower Descendants 2001, unless otherwise noted.

NOTE: Windham County was created in 1726 from Hartford and New London counties.

Art Brown had David as born in Canterbury but Austin says Chelmsford.That appears to be more likely.

Austin has this:
"Administration of the estate of Jonathan Adams, late of Canterbury, was granted to father David Adams of Norwich CT 8 June 1756. David Adams presented an inventory of Jonathan's estate 13 July 1756.
Distribution of seven 14-acre parcels which Elisha Paine, late of Canterbury, deceased, gave to dau. Dorcas Adams, wife of David and both late of Canterbury, deceased, was made 4 April 1770 to: Levi Adams (second son), Abel Adams (third son), Elisha Adams (fourth son), Leah Cain (second dau., wife of Isiah Cain), Rebekah Adams (third dau.), heirs of Jonathan Adams, deceased, late of Canterbury (eldest son) and heirs of Constance Reynolds, deceased, late wife of Robert Reynolds (eldest dau.)."

"History of Our Branch of The Adams Family" has another child attributed to David and Dorcas - David, born _____, married 30 Sep 1746, to Sarah Jackson. It also did not include Constance, which Austin had.
